Photo: NFLThe Falcons’ Outside Zone RushThe Falcons averaged 120.5 rushing yards per game this season, led by the two-back running attack of Devonta Freeman and Tevin Coleman. Zone blocking clears a path for Falcons running back Devonta Freeman. “If there’s anybody that throws the ball less than 50 yards more often than anybody else, it’s the New England Patriots. Photo: NFLThe Patriots’ Slip ScreenThe Patriots love to run the screen to either James White or Dion Lewis. Facing a third-and-2 against the Steelers in Week 7, the Patriots lined up in a four-receiver set.
